Why seasonal demand planning matters on the Zen Pro
Order production slots well ahead of the peak to avoid factory congestion.
Seasonality interacts with seasonal demand planning more than most forecasts allow for, so a rolling review beats an annual one.
Build a buffer for promotional periods rather than reordering at the last minute.

Frequently asked questions
When should Zen Pro peak season stock be ordered?
Roughly eight to twelve weeks before the expected peak, allowing for production and transit.
Do you support long term supply agreements?
Yes, rolling agreements with defined review points work better for both sides than rigid annual commitments.
How quickly can a repeat order be produced?
For established configurations production typically runs two to four weeks, with transit on top depending on the chosen method.
What happens if a batch fails inspection?
The agreed procedure normally covers replacement of affected units or credit against the next order, documented before shipment.
